  18. @boomer2840 Good question 😂 The LSPDFR Edition is built specifically for LSPDFR and Rage Plugin Hook, allowing deeper integration and more advanced possibilities later on. The Standalone Edition is designed for regular GTA V using ScriptHookVDotNet and does not require LSPDFR. Both versions aim to provide the same Ambient Emergency Traffic experience, but certain future features may differ due to framework limitations. Standalone = GTA V players LSPDFR Edition = LSPDFR players Both will continue receiving support and updates. @javier0911 Honestly, neither is "better" overall — it depends on what you play. If you play LSPDFR, grab the LSPDFR Edition. If you play regular GTA V without LSPDFR, grab the Standalone Edition. The goal is for both versions to feel as close as possible while supporting different setups. As for updates 👀 yes, future updates are planned.
